The Nine Emperor Gods are part of a cult known locally as Jieu Hwang Yeh. They influence blessings, peace and harmony as well as life and death. The festival, during which the gods are believed to return to earth, spans the first nine days of the ninth lunar month. On the eve of the ninth moon, temples hold a ceremony to welcome the Jien Hwang Yeh. Devotees dressed in white, carrying joss-sticks and candles, await the arrival of their Excellencies. There is a carnival-like atmosphere and most devotees stay at the temple, have vegetarian meals and recite continuous prayers.
